Iul. Alas.
Pro. Pro.
Pro. Why do'st thou cry alas?
Iul. I cannot choose but pitty her.
Pro. Wherefore should'st thou pitty her?
Iul. Because, me thinkes that she lou'd you as well
Iul. As you doe loue your Lady Siluia:
Iul. She dreames on him, that has forgot her loue,
Iul. You doate on her, that cares not for your loue.
Iul. 'Tis pitty Loue, should be so contrary;
Iul. And thinking on it makes me cry alas.
Pro. Well: giue her that Ring, and therewithall
Pro. This Letter: that's her chamber: Tell my Lady
Pro. I claime the promise for her heauenly Picture:
Pro. Your message done, hye home vnto my chamber,
